In 2019, a skier sued. Plaintiff alleges in court documents that Hollywood actress Gwyneth Paltrow, 50, slipped “out of control” on a slope and injured her in a collision. The incident occurred in 2016 at the Deer Valley ski area in the US state of Utah.
In the civil lawsuit that began Tuesday, the 50-year-old now has to answer in court in Ohio. The victim of the accident, a retired optician, accused the Oscar winner (“Shakespeare in Love”) of hitting and seriously injuring him while skiing in the Rocky Mountains.
Four broken ribs and permanent brain damage
Plaintiff’s lawyer, Lawrence Buhler, said Paltrow had driven “dangerously” and “recklessly”, causing Terry Sanderson “fracture of all four ribs and permanent brain damage”. But that’s not all: Paltrow continued to drive while Sanderson passed out. Loss amounted to $3.3 million (€3.1 million).
Paltrow’s attorney, Steven Owens, dismissed the allegations as “totally BS” (bullshit; German: bullshit). Sanderson was “obsessed” with the case and was making “false allegations”.
In fact, it was Sanderson who entered Paltrow from behind at the glamorous Deer Valley ski resort in February 2016, Owens said. At first, the actress even thought that she was the victim of an attack. The actor filed a counterclaim, demanding a dollar coin for damages and attorneys’ fees from Sanderson.
